Jessica Foli
Actor | Dancer | Singer | Physical Theatre
Jessica holds a Bachelor of Fine Art degree (with distinction in Drama & Sculpture) from Rhodes University. Her experience spans theatre, television, and site-specific performance. She has appeared in theatre productions such as “A Seussified Christmas Carol” and “Khokho’s Treasure” with the National Children’s Theatre, as well as “The Sound of Music” with Pieter Toerien Productions. Her television credits include “Generations: The Legacy “and “MTV Shuga Down South.”As a theatre-maker and artist, Jessica is dedicated to exploring the experiences of Black women through her work. Most recently, she performed at the 2024 “Infecting the City Public Art Festival” in Cape Town and was a finalist in the 2024 “Sasol New Signatures Art Competition.” Through her work, she continues to challenge narratives, spark conversations, and create work that resonates deeply with audiences.
